libyang FEATURE introduce and use new ly_bool type
To indicate simple flags or true/false return values, use a standalone
ly_bool type.
We do not use stdbool's bool type to avoid need to mimic all its
features on platforms that do not provide it. ly_bool is just a simple
rename for uint8_t and the reason to use it is only a better readability
of the meaning of the variables or function's return values.
